The Weber Spirit II E-210 is a smaller, two-burner version of our top pick; the materials and build are identical. The E-210 is 4 inches narrower, and its cooking area is 15% smaller, but it still provides enough space to snugly fit a cut-up whole chicken or six to eight burger patties. Charcoal is easy to pick up at just about every grocery store, home improvement store, or gas station, so you won’t need to make a special trip. But you’ll need to have a charcoal starter on hand, will have to wait for everything to cool down before you can dispose of it, and need to deal with the messy ash afterward.
